Flaky integration tests in the Perrow payments service trace to the ledger sandbox resetting mid-run. Retries mask the failure but inflate suite time by 40%. Proposal for this week: pin the sandbox snapshot per run and quarantine the three worst offenders. Repro data is in the sync folder. To replay the failing suite against the pinned sandbox, use the credential that follows.

session JWT of yawep-yawep = eyJhbGciOiJIUzI1NiIsInR5cCI6IkpXVCJ9.eyJzdWIiOiI3pWF3_In0.aXYsHiog

**Handover: tailfox CLI maintenance**

Passing tailfox ownership to you ahead of the Orrery 3.1 release. The log-tailing streams are stable, but the credential cache occasionally corrupts after agent restarts; the fix is queued for next sprint. If the cache corrupts during release week, reset it with `tailfox auth reset`, which will prompt for the recovery passphrase below.

recovery phrase for bawef-haduf: wenax-druox-julmir

Alert: rate-parity-checker-stalled

Fires when the Inncompass parity checker hasn't compared Drift Hotel rates across channels in over 4 hours. Security-relevant because a stall can mask scraped-credential lockouts upstream. Check the scraper auth logs first. If anything looks like credential abuse, escalate straight to the review queue at the address below.

pager mailbox: silael.sorwyn.tamius@zemvarsys.corp

## Deployment

Brindlecast report exports now emit UTC timestamps only; display conversion happens in the viewer. Do not re-enable the legacy local-time path — it caused the duplicate-row incident during the Fenwick quarter close. Deploy the exporter before the viewer, never the reverse. Smoke-test with a tenant in a non-UTC region. The exporter service reads the following configuration values on startup.

settings of yaguf-bahip:
druwyn:
  log_level: debug
  metrics_host: metrics.druwyn.qorvelsys.internal
  pool_size: 32

This alert triggers when the Tumblekey laundry-locker flow issues an unlock without a completed identity challenge. It indicates a bypass of the verification step, possibly via a replayed session token. Treat any occurrence as a potential access-control failure and preserve the request logs. The full threat model and triage checklist are on the internal page here.

wiki page, tahaf-tajog: https://jira.ordindyn.corp/pipeline